Output 036f65ccc320b2c5652f0def5ce71c0d0e61863caa65afd1d0bb7694c7542584:0

value
6977124666446
script pubkey
OP_0 OP_PUSHBYTES_20 cd97e63d302a0d18e32e6b4ae1b2011b985a8a0a
address
tb1qekt7v0fs9gx33cewdd9wrvsprwv94zs2jsf3w4
transaction
036f65ccc320b2c5652f0def5ce71c0d0e61863caa65afd1d0bb7694c7542584
confirmations
186920
spent
true